Build:
- 0
2024-11-03 22:53.55: New job: Voodoo prep datalog.0.3.1; f7fc2336e51c374bc9ee1891b03014cb 2024-11-03 22:53.55: Waiting for resource in pool OCluster 2024-11-03 22:55.19: Waiting for worker… 2024-11-03 22:55.19: Got resource from pool OCluster 2024-11-03 22:55.19: Using cache hint "docs-universe-prep-5.0.0" To reproduce locally: cat > prep.spec <<'END-OF-SPEC' ((build tools ((from ocaml/opam:debian-12-ocaml-5.0@s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39) (user (uid 1000) (gid 1000)) (workdir /home/opam) (run (shell "sudo chown opam:opam /home/opam")) (run (network host) (shell "sudo apt-get update && sudo apt-get install -yy m4 pkg-config")) (run (cache (opam-archives (target /home/opam/.opam/download-cache)) (opam-dune-cache (target /home/opam/.cache/dune))) (network host) (shell "opam pin -ny https://github.com/ocaml-doc/voodoo.git#67ccabec49b5f4d24147839291fcae7c19d3e8c9 && opam depext -iy voodoo-prep")) (run (shell "cp $(opam config var bin)/voodoo-prep /home/opam")))) (from ocaml/opam:debian-12-ocaml-5.0@s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39) (user (uid 1000) (gid 1000)) (workdir /home/opam) (run (shell "sudo chown opam:opam /home/opam")) (run (shell "sudo mkdir /src")) (copy (src packages) (dst /src/packages)) (copy (src repo) (dst /src/repo)) (run (network host) (shell "sudo ln -f /usr/bin/opam-2.1 /usr/bin/opam && opam init --reinit -ni")) (run (shell "opam repo remove default && opam repo add opam /src")) (copy (from (build tools)) (src /home/opam/voodoo-prep) (dst /home/opam/)) (run (cache (opam-archives (target /home/opam/.opam/download-cache)) (opam-dune-cache (target /home/opam/.cache/dune))) (network host) (shell "opam install ocamlfind.1.9.6")) (env DUNE_CACHE disabled) (env DUNE_CACHE_TRANSPORT direct) (env DUNE_CACHE_DUPLICATION copy) (run (cache (opam-archives (target /home/opam/.opam/download-cache)) (opam-dune-cache (target /home/opam/.cache/dune))) (network host) (shell "(sudo apt update) && ((opam depext -viy datalog.0.3.1 ocamlfind.1.9.6 ocamlbuild.0.15.0 2>&1 | tee ~/opam.err.log) || echo 'Failed to install all packages')")) (run (shell "opam exec -- ~/voodoo-prep -u datalog:f7fc2336e51c374bc9ee1891b03014cb,ocamlfind:ce47b14da4853a86e05f83d7674348ea,ocamlbuild:ce47b14da4853a86e05f83d7674348ea")) (run (network host) (secrets (ssh_privkey (target /home/opam/.ssh/id_rsa)) (ssh_pubkey (target /home/opam/.ssh/id_rsa.pub)) (ssh_config (target /home/opam/.ssh/config))) (shell "(echo '0.056483') && (for DATA in prep/universes/ce47b14da4853a86e05f83d7674348ea/ocamlbuild/0.15.0,ocamlbuild.0.15.0-ce47b14da4853a86e05f83d7674348ea,ocamlbuild.0.15.0 prep/universes/ce47b14da4853a86e05f83d7674348ea/ocamlfind/1.9.6,ocamlfind.1.9.6-ce47b14da4853a86e05f83d7674348ea,ocamlfind.1.9.6 prep/universes/f7fc2336e51c374bc9ee1891b03014cb/datalog/0.3.1,datalog.0.3.1-f7fc2336e51c374bc9ee1891b03014cb,datalog.0.3.1; do IFS=\",\"; set -- $DATA; ([ -d $1 ] || (echo \"FAILED:$2\" && mkdir -p $1 && cp ~/opam.err.log $1 && opam show $3 --raw > $1/opam)) && (shopt -s nullglob && ((tar -cvf $1.tar $1/* && rm -R $1/* && mv $1.tar $1/content.tar) || (echo 'Empty directory'))) done) && (for DATA in prep/universes/ce47b14da4853a86e05f83d7674348ea/ocamlbuild/0.15.0,ocamlbuild.0.15.0-ce47b14da4853a86e05f83d7674348ea,ocamlbuild.0.15.0 prep/universes/ce47b14da4853a86e05f83d7674348ea/ocamlfind/1.9.6,ocamlfind.1.9.6-ce47b14da4853a86e05f83d7674348ea,ocamlfind.1.9.6 prep/universes/f7fc2336e51c374bc9ee1891b03014cb/datalog/0.3.1,datalog.0.3.1-f7fc2336e51c374bc9ee1891b03014cb,datalog.0.3.1; do IFS=\",\"; set -- $DATA; rsync -aR --no-p ./$1 docs.ci.ocaml.org:/data/.; done) && (for DATA in prep/universes/ce47b14da4853a86e05f83d7674348ea/ocamlbuild/0.15.0,ocamlbuild.0.15.0-ce47b14da4853a86e05f83d7674348ea,ocamlbuild.0.15.0 prep/universes/ce47b14da4853a86e05f83d7674348ea/ocamlfind/1.9.6,ocamlfind.1.9.6-ce47b14da4853a86e05f83d7674348ea,ocamlfind.1.9.6 prep/universes/f7fc2336e51c374bc9ee1891b03014cb/datalog/0.3.1,datalog.0.3.1-f7fc2336e51c374bc9ee1891b03014cb,datalog.0.3.1; do IFS=\",\"; set -- $DATA; HASH=$((sha256sum $1/content.tar | cut -d \" \" -f 1) || echo -n 'empty'); printf \"HASHES:$2:$HASH\\n\"; done)")) ) END-OF-SPEC ocluster-client submit-obuilder https://github.com/ocaml/opam-repository.git 8e6145c5ce4176c1b7e92a06414442da0d05766c --local-file prep.spec \ --pool linux-x86_64 --connect ocluster-submission.cap --cache-hint docs-universe-prep-5.0.0 \ --secret ssh_privkey:id_rsa --secret ssh_pubkey:id_rsa.pub--secret ssh_config:ssh_config 2024-11-03 22:55.19: RETRYING: 2024-11-03/225355-voodoo-prep-0510b5 Number of retries: 0 (retriable error condition) Building on x86-bm-c6.sw.ocaml.org All commits already cached Updating files: 59% (19218/32566) Updating files: 60% (19540/32566) Updating files: 61% (19866/32566) Updating files: 62% (20191/32566) Updating files: 63% (20517/32566) Updating files: 64% (20843/32566) Updating files: 65% (21168/32566) Updating files: 66% (21494/32566) Updating files: 67% (21820/32566) Updating files: 68% (22145/32566) Updating files: 69% (22471/32566) Updating files: 70% (22797/32566) Updating files: 71% (23122/32566) Updating files: 72% (23448/32566) Updating files: 73% (23774/32566) Updating files: 74% (24099/32566) Updating files: 75% (24425/32566) Updating files: 76% (24751/32566) Updating files: 77% (25076/32566) Updating files: 78% (25402/32566) Updating files: 79% (25728/32566) Updating files: 80% (26053/32566) Updating files: 81% (26379/32566) Updating files: 82% (26705/32566) Updating files: 83% (27030/32566) Updating files: 84% (27356/32566) Updating files: 85% (27682/32566) Updating files: 86% (28007/32566) Updating files: 87% (28333/32566) Updating files: 88% (28659/32566) Updating files: 89% (28984/32566) Updating files: 90% (29310/32566) Updating files: 91% (29636/32566) Updating files: 92% (29961/32566) Updating files: 93% (30287/32566) Updating files: 94% (30613/32566) Updating files: 95% (30938/32566) Updating files: 96% (31264/32566) Updating files: 97% (31590/32566) Updating files: 98% (31915/32566) Updating files: 99% (32241/32566) Updating files: 100% (32566/32566) Updating files: 100% (32566/32566), done. HEAD is now at 8e6145c5ce Fill out metadata to placate OPAM linter (build "tools" …) (from ocaml/opam:debian-12-ocaml-5.0@s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39) Unable to find image 'ocaml/opam:debian-12-ocaml-5.0@s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39' locally docker.io/ocaml/opam@s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39: Pulling from ocaml/opam 53ec4596aca2: Pulling fs layer 53ec4596aca2: Verifying Checksum 53ec4596aca2: Download complete 53ec4596aca2: Pull complete Digest: s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39 Status: Downloaded newer image for ocaml/opam@sha256:2d958bb8e22e6a82fa6daf5ac5106fe3469719c185c81ba153569043d3d32f39 2024-11-03 22:49.39 ---> saved as "abed148febf39b33dd9a602764a809a471bc3a674a2a8eed4f031b35e3d841bd" /: (user (uid 1000) (gid 1000)) /: (workdir /home/opam) /home/opam: (run (shell "sudo chown opam:opam /home/opam")) 2024-11-03 22:49.39 ---> saved as "82a3150a90d7e9a02b3315c520a5d020d549666542eeb4ec50e6654fa9ae3ec5" /home/opam: (run (network host) (shell "sudo apt-get update && sudo apt-get install -yy m4 pkg-config")) Hit:1 http://deb.debian.org/debian bookworm InRelease Get:2 http://deb.debian.org/debian bookworm-updates InRelease [55.4 kB] Get:3 http://deb.debian.org/debian-security bookworm-security InRelease [48.0 kB] Get:4 http://deb.debian.org/debian-security bookworm-security/main amd64 Packages [190 kB] Fetched 293 kB in 0s (1294 kB/s) Reading package lists... Reading package lists... Building dependency tree... Reading state information... The following additional packages will be installed: libpkgconf3 pkgconf pkgconf-bin Suggested packages: m4-doc The following NEW packages will be installed: libpkgconf3 m4 pkg-config pkgconf pkgconf-bin 0 upgraded, 5 newly installed, 0 to remove and 1 not upgraded. Need to get 392 kB of archives. After this operation, 969 kB of additional disk space will be used. Get:1 http://deb.debian.org/debian bookworm/main amd64 libpkgconf3 amd64 1.8.1-1 [36.1 kB] Get:2 http://deb.debian.org/debian bookworm/main amd64 m4 amd64 1.4.19-3 [287 kB] Get:3 http://deb.debian.org/debian bookworm/main amd64 pkgconf-bin amd64 1.8.1-1 [29.5 kB] Get:4 http://deb.debian.org/debian bookworm/main amd64 pkgconf amd64 1.8.1-1 [25.9 kB] Get:5 http://deb.debian.org/debian bookworm/main amd64 pkg-config amd64 1.8.1-1 [13.7 kB] debconf: delaying package configuration, since apt-utils is not installed Fetched 392 kB in 0s (18.0 MB/s) Selecting previously unselected package libpkgconf3:amd64. (Reading database ... (Reading database ... 5% (Reading database ... 10% (Reading database ... 15% (Reading database ... 20% (Reading database ... 25% (Reading database ... 30% (Reading database ... 35% (Reading database ... 40% (Reading database ... 45% (Reading database ... 50% (Reading database ... 55% (Reading database ... 60% (Reading database ... 65% (Reading database ... 70% (Reading database ... 75% (Reading database ... 80% (Reading database ... 85% (Reading database ... 90% (Reading database ... 95% (Reading database ... 100% (Reading database ... 18745 files and directories currently installed.) Preparing to unpack .../libpkgconf3_1.8.1-1_amd64.deb ... Unpacking libpkgconf3:amd64 (1.8.1-1) ... Selecting previously unselected package m4. Preparing to unpack .../archives/m4_1.4.19-3_amd64.deb ... Unpacking m4 (1.4.19-3) ... Selecting previously unselected package pkgconf-bin. Preparing to unpack .../pkgconf-bin_1.8.1-1_amd64.deb ... Unpacking pkgconf-bin (1.8.1-1) ... Selecting previously unselected package pkgconf:amd64. Preparing to unpack .../pkgconf_1.8.1-1_amd64.deb ... Unpacking pkgconf:amd64 (1.8.1-1) ... Selecting previously unselected package pkg-config:amd64. Preparing to unpack .../pkg-config_1.8.1-1_amd64.deb ... Unpacking pkg-config:amd64 (1.8.1-1) ... Setting up m4 (1.4.19-3) ... Setting up libpkgconf3:amd64 (1.8.1-1) ... Setting up pkgconf-bin (1.8.1-1) ... Setting up pkgconf:amd64 (1.8.1-1) ... Setting up pkg-config:amd64 (1.8.1-1) ... Processing triggers for libc-bin (2.36-9+deb12u8) ... 2024-11-03 22:49.41 ---> saved as "4462d1feed77a290bac64dffa94c5bb69d119155ce6b3953237f427350942918" /home/opam: (run (cache (opam-archives (target /home/opam/.opam/download-cache)) (opam-dune-cache (target /home/opam/.cache/dune))) (network host) (shell "opam pin -ny https://github.com/ocaml-doc/voodoo.git#67ccabec49b5f4d24147839291fcae7c19d3e8c9 && opam depext -iy voodoo-prep")) [voodoo: git] [voodoo: git] [voodoo: git] [voodoo: git] [voodoo: git] [voodoo: git] [voodoo: git] [ERROR] Could not synchronize /tmp/opam-pin-cache-7-5a61c5/448cfbe9dcb57ede from "git+https://github.com/ocaml-doc/voodoo.git#67ccabec49b5f4d24147839291fcae7c19d3e8c9": "/usr/bin/git fetch -q" exited with code 128 "error: Could not read b8e715d299a967336fc71901674cd117ee93dc49" [ERROR] Could not retrieve git+https://github.com/ocaml-doc/voodoo.git#67ccabec49b5f4d24147839291fcae7c19d3e8c9 "/usr/bin/env" "bash" "-c" "opam pin -ny https://github.com/ocaml-doc/voodoo.git#67ccabec49b5f4d24147839291fcae7c19d3e8c9 && opam depext -iy voodoo-prep" failed with exit status 40 2024-11-03 22:56.23: Job failed: Failed: Build failed